Blog
Yazılım, günümüzde çok büyük önem kazanan bir sistemdir. Bu sebeple de birçok kişi yazılım ne olduğunu ve nereden başlanacağını merak eder. Büyük bir iş kapısı haline de gelen yazılım, İzmir yazılım kursu gibi kurslar tarafından da profesyonel düzeyde öğretilebilmektedir.
Peki, yazılıma nereden başlamalıyız? Gelin tüm ayrıntıları ile bunu beraber öğrenelim.
Yazılım Nedir?
Tıbbi cihazlar, bilgisayarlar, otomobiller, akıllı telefonlar, fabrikalar ve işyerleri gibi birçok alan içerisinde yer alan cihazlar, belirli işlev ve özelliklere sahiptir. Bu özelliklere sahip olabilmek için ise programlama dillerinde ve kodlama sistemlerinde belirli bir düzeye gelmeniz gerekir. Bu sayede kodlar ve komut dizileri ile yazılım işlemlerini yapabilirsiniz. Bunların tamamını yapabilenlere ise günümüzde yazılımcı denmektedir.
Programlama dilleri çok çeşitlidir ve fabrika içerisinde yer alan bir cihaza aynı işlevi sağlayacak olan birçok programlama dili bulabilirsiniz. Bunun sebebi ise yıllardır insanların programlama dilleri üzerinde gelişim çalışmaları yapmalarıdır. Aynı işler üzerinde çalışma yapmalarına rağmen bunları farklı kılan ana özellik, bir programa nazaran diğerinin bu işi çok daha kolaylaştırıcı bir teknik ile yapıyor olmasıdır. Bir adet CNC makinesi düşünün. Bu makinenin yaptığı işlemi 3 işlemli bir şekilde yapabiliyorken tek işlemli seviyelere de çekebilirsiniz. Bu da tamamen yazılıma bağlı olarak değişiklik gösterir.İzmir yazılım kursları, yazılıma dair birçok detaylı özelliği size en iyi şekilde öğretmektedir. Bu ve bunun gibi kurslar sayesinde kendinizi çok daha iyi konumlara çıkarabilirsiniz.
Programlama Dilleri Nelerdir?
Günümüzde kullanılan programlama dilleri, insanlarda var olan mantık ile makineler içerisinde yer alan mantığın oluşturulmasını sağlayan dillerdir. Yani bu programlama dilleri ile ikisinin arasında bir köprü oluşturursunuz. Bu aracı niteliğinde yer alan uygulamalar, insanlar ve makineler arasındaki iletişim sağlanmasını amaçlamaktadır. İsterseniz bir kullanıcı olun isterseniz de bir geliştirici, bu programlama dilleri olmadan herhangi bir işlem yapabilme şansınız yoktur. Bu sebepten dolayı da iletişim kurmak için bu programlama dilleri tüm yazılım işlemlerinde aktif olarak kullanılır.
Bilgisayarın ilk üretildiği anı birçoğumuz bilmeyiz. Bu bilgisayarlar ile günümüzde var olan bilgisayarlar arasındaki çok büyük farklar vardır. Hatta o dönemlerde var olan programlamalarda yalnızca 0 ve 1 kullanılıyordu. 0 ve 1 sistemi üzerine kurulan programlamalara bir programlama demek dahi yanlış olabilir. Bunun sebebi ise var ve yok üzerinde bir çalışma yapmasıdır. İlk çıkan bilgisayarlarda yer alan 0 “elektriksel akım yok” anlamına gelirken, 1 ise “elektriksel akım var” anlamına gelmekteydi. Var olan bu 0 ve 1 ile bilgisayar devreleri içerisinde çok basit halde bulunan fonksiyonlar üretiliyordu. Bugün ki durumumuz ile incelendiğinde çok basit ve yararsız gibi görülen bu fonksiyonlar, o zamanlarda bir devrin başlangıcı olacak şekilde nitelendiriliyordu.
Yazılım Öğrenmeye Nereden Başlamalıyım?
Online yazılım eğitimi, bu başlangıç aşamasında sizler için mükemmel bir seçenek olabilir. Bu eğitimler içerisinde ihtiyaç duyduğunuz birçok özelliğe sahip olarak fonksiyonel bir çalışma yürütebilecek düzeye gelebilirsiniz.
Yazılım, programlama ve kodlama gibi sistemleri öğrenmek, kişiler için uykusuz gecelerin başlaması demektir. Bu süreçler içerisinde zihinsel olarak çok fazla yorulacak ve sürekli olarak da çalışacaksınız. Bu detayları öğrendikten sonra sizler ile beraber yazılım öğrenmek için nereden başlanması konusuna bir başlangıç yapabiliriz.
Eğer programlama ya da yazılım öğrenmek istiyorsanız, bu aşamada yabancı dilinizin yani İngilizcenizin iyi olmasında büyük yarar vardır. Bunun sebebi ise programlama dili içerisinde yer alan algoritmaların ve komutların tamamen İngilizce olarak var olmasıdır. Eğer yabancı diliniz yeterli seviyede değilse, bir İngilizce kursuna katılarak dil öğrenmeniz size fayda sağlayacaktır. Bu sayede programlamalar içerisindeki komutları da rahatlıkla anlayabileceksiniz. Fakat İngilizce öğrenmeniz kesinlikle gerekli olan bir aşama değildir. Eğer İngilizceye sahip değilseniz var olan komutları, işlevleri ve yazım şekillerini ezberleme aşamasını tercih edebilirsiniz. Zaten ezber yeteneğiniz iyi bir seviyedeyse, belirli bir zaman sonra tüm komutlar hakkında fikir sahibi olacak ve geriye dönüp bakmadan bu kodları kullanmaya başlayacaksınız. Ancak İngilizce seviyenizin iyi olması, komutun adını duyduğunuz anda dahi o komut hakkında bir fikir sahibi olmanızı sağlayarak sizlere avantaj sağlayacaktır.
Online yazılım kursu gibi alanlarda da genel olarak bu kodlamalar İngilizce olarak kullanılır.Daha önce herhangi bir yerde eğitim görmemiş ve bilgi sahibi değilseniz, programlama konusunda çok büyük bir merak ve çalışma tutkusuna sahip olmanız gerekir. Eğer bu tutkuya sahip değilseniz tüm bu işlemlerden kısa sürede sıkılacak ve sektör içerisinde ilerleme şansı bulamayacaksınız. Eğer yeterli seviyede merak sahibiyim diyorsanız, ilk olarak basit kodlama adımlarını anlatan eğitimler ile işe başlamanız gerekir. İnternet üzerinde yer alan videolar ve çeşitli oyunlar ile bu kodlamaları pekiştirmeniz de mümkündür.
Yazılıma başlamak isteyenler için günümüzde birçok devlet gibi Türkiye’nin de yaptığı programlar vardır. Bu programlar belirli bir düzey dahilinde yazılım öğrenmenizi sağlayabilir. Ancak İzmir yazılım kursu gibi kurslara katılmak sizler için hem çok daha profesyonel hem de daha kapsamlı bir bilgi aktarımı sağlayacaktır.
İnternet üzerinde yer alan çeşitli platformlar, yazılıma nereden başlamanız gerektiği konusunda fikirler veren kurslar satmaktadır. Çeşitli zaman dilimlerinde indirime giren bu kurslar, fırsatların yakalanması ile uygun fiyatlardan satın alınabilir.
Tüm bunların haricinde direkt olarak yazılıma bir yerden başlamak istiyorsanız HTML, CSS ve JavaScript gibi uygulamaların öğrenim adımlarını atmalısınız. Bu programlama dillerinde yapacak olduğunuz araştırmalar, kodlamalar ve diğer işlevler hakkında da deneyim kazanmanızı sağlayacaktır. Kendiniz için bir internet sitesi oluşturma süreci düşünebilirsiniz. Bu süreç dahilinde tüm eğitimleri alabilir ve aldığınız bilgiler ile beraber HTML, CSS gibi uygulamaları sitenizde kullanabilirsiniz. Bu sayede gerçek bir deneyim kazanarak öğrenme aşamanızda hızlanacaktır.
Günümüzde eğitim veren online yazılım kursu gibi çeşitler de vardır. Bu yazılım kursu fiyatları, insanların yazılım öğrenebilmesi için her zaman ekonomik fiyatlardan oluşur. Bu sebeple de günümüzde birçok kişi bu online yazılım kurslarından faydalanarak yazılım ve kodlama öğrenmektedir. Sizler de bu kurslara katılım sağlayarak ekonomik fiyat ayrıcalıklarından yararlanabilirsiniz. Bu, sizler için atılabilecek en iyi adım olacaktır.